Evangelista slams Sporting, accuses Varandas of illegal acts

Image de l'article :Evangelista slams Sporting, accuses Varandas of illegal acts

Joaquim Evangelista spoke about the controversy between Jeremiah St. Juste and Sporting. The president of the Players’ Union harshly criticized the decision of the club’s board, led by Frederico Varandas, for demoting the player to the B team, referring to “unlawful acts.”

Joaquim Evangelista: “St. Juste? He should reserve the right to decide his future and to fulfill the employment contract he signed.”

“Training separately, demoting a player to a secondary team, or releasing him, preventing him from training, are these lawful acts when the club’s intention is to dispense with the player’s services ahead of time? Obviously not,” said the president of the Professional Football Players’ Union (SPJF) to the newspaper Record.

Although he understands Sporting’s position, Joaquim Evangelista believes that St. Juste and any other player should have a say regarding their future: “It is understandable that a club, in its sporting management, may want to dispense with a player’s services, or may be eager to make a financially advantageous transfer, but what cannot happen is for this to be done at the expense of the player’s will, who should reserve the right to decide his future and to fulfill the employment contract he signed.”

Joaquim Evangelista: “Solutions outside this vicious circle are needed”

The problem is not with the legal framework, but with the means of response, which involve the need to notify the employer to put an end to conduct considered unlawful and, once evidence is gathered and maintaining the employment relationship becomes unsustainable, to decide to proceed with unilateral termination for just cause,” added the SPJF president regarding the Dutch player’s situation.

In conclusion, Joaquim Evangelista advocates for the creation of a new solution to resolve situations like the one Jeremiah St. Juste is currently experiencing at Sporting: “Solutions outside this vicious circle are needed, and there are experiences in other countries such as the establishment of a body with representatives from players, clubs, and the League to consider complaints of this type and decide on the restoration of the player’s working conditions, under penalty of sporting sanctions being applied,” he concluded. The player’s situation is only expected to be resolved in the winter transfer window.
